Parameter Description
Quality
This parameter can be configured only when the
Bit Rate Type
is set
as
VBR
.
The better the quality is, but the bigger the required bandwidth will
be.
Reference Bit Rate
The most suitable bit rate value range recommended to user
according to the defined resolution and frame rate.
Bit Rate
This parameter can be configured only when the
Bit Rate Type
is set
as
CBR
.
Select bit rate value in the list according to actual condition.
I Frame Interval
The number of P frames between two I frames, and the
I Frame
Interval
range changes as
FPS
changes.
It is recommended to set
I Frame Interval
twice as big as
FPS
.
SVC
Scaled video coding, is able to encode a high quality video bit
stream that contains one or more subset bit streams. When sending
stream, to improve fluency, the system will quit some data of related
lays according to the network status.
1: The default value, which means that there is no layered
coding.
2, 3 and 4: The lay number that the video stream is packed.
Watermark
You can verify the watermark to check if the video has been
tampered.

4.3.3.2.1 Configuring Privacy Masking
You can enable this function when you need to protect the privacy of some area on the image.
Step 1 Select >
Camera
>
Encode
>
Overlay
.
Step 2 Select the channel.
Select
1
in
Channel
to set the parameters of visible channel.
Select
2
in
Channel
to set the parameters of thermal channel.
Step 3 Click the
Privacy Masking
tab.
Step 4 Click next to
Enable
.
Step 5 Click
Add
, and then drag the block to the area that you need to cover.
You can draw four blocks at most.
Click
Clear
to delete all the area boxes; you can also just select one block, and click
to delete it.
Step 6 Adjust the size of the rectangle to protect the privacy.
